### **Pain Management Software Market Pain Type Insights**

The Pain Management Software Market is segmented into chronic pain, acute pain, and cancer pain. Chronic pain is the most common type of pain, affecting over 1.5 billion people worldwide. It is defined as pain that lasts for more than 12 weeks and can be caused by a variety of conditions, such as arthritis, back pain, and fibromyalgia. Acute pain is pain that lasts for less than 12 weeks and is typically caused by an injury or surgery. Cancer pain is pain that is caused by cancer and can be either acute or chronic.

Smaller companies and startups are emerging with niche offerings and specialized solutions, contributing to the diversification of the Pain Management Software Market Competitive Landscape.Epic Systems is a leading player in the Pain Management Software Market. The company's comprehensive electronic health record (EHR) system, EpicCare, incorporates pain management modules that enable clinicians to assess, diagnose, and treat pain effectively. EpicCare's pain management tools include pain assessment scales, pain medication management, and patient education resources. The software's interoperability with other systems allows for seamless data sharing and coordination of care.

Epic Systems' strong market position is attributed to its extensive customer base, established reputation for reliability, and continuous investment in research and development.Another prominent player in the Pain Management Software Market is Cerner Corporation. Cerner's Millennium EHR system offers integrated pain management solutions that support evidence-based practices. 

The software features pain assessment tools, medication management, and clinical decision support capabilities. Cerner's focus on patient engagement and population health management aligns with the growing emphasis on patient-centered care in pain management. The company's strategic partnerships with healthcare organizations and its commitment to innovation have contributed to its strong market presence.

Key factors driving market growth include the rising prevalence of chronic pain conditions, increasing adoption of electronic health records (EHRs), and technological advancements in pain management software.Recent news developments in the market include In February 2023, Orion Health, a leading provider of healthcare IT solutions, acquired IMS Health's pain management software business.

This acquisition strengthens Orion Health's position in the pain management software market and expands its offerings to include a comprehensive suite of solutions for pain assessment, treatment planning, and monitoring. In March 2023, the American Academy of Pain Medicine (AAPM) released new guidelines for the use of opioids in chronic pain management. These guidelines emphasize the importance of using opioids judiciously and in combination with non-opioid therapies, such as pain management software, to achieve optimal pain relief while minimizing the risk of misuse and addiction.

In April 2023, the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) announced new payment models for pain management services. These models aim to incentivize healthcare providers to use evidence-based pain management practices, including the use of pain management software, to improve patient outcomes and reduce healthcare costs.
